There's nothing more terrifying than a pissed off woman - except the Devil. I'm both.
The angels warned me that I should fear their wrath. Theirs? Please! They have no idea who they're dealing with. Not that I really do either, but I'm quickly figuring out that I'm a whole lot more than just an artist.
Designed by God, created by people, and made possible by the atrocities of the supposed "good guys," I'm here to set things right. To punish those who deserve it, and the archangel Michael is at the top of my list. That guy can't help but piss me off.
I just have a few things to deal with first. You know, like the mess I made of Hell. And no, I don't feel bad about that. They completely deserved it. They also learned their lesson.
The angels honestly think their attitude problem should scare me? Me! I'm God's equal. I'm supposed to be the "bad guy," after all. I'm here to bring down Heaven and unleash chaos on the world.
The Wrath of Angels?
No, there's something much, much worse:
A woman on a mission.

Auryn Hadley is an American girl who swelters in the summers with her husband, three dogs, and the neighborhood cats. Her coffee addiction is impressive and allows her to keep writing the next book. Her husband keeps telling her it's great, even though he doesn't like to read, so she ignores him.With a degree in biology, a few decades in gaming, and a love for all things out of this world, she writes across genres looking for the story that is begging to be told. From love to loss, hopes and dreams, there's always an escape waiting inside the pages of her books. She tries to capture the idealism of New Adult literature while addressing more adult topics because life doesn't get any less exciting when you grow up.
